Несколько доработок на самописном сайте (добавить коды)
1000 UAHСейчас по нажатию кнопки в админке сайта генерируются рандомные числа за каждым клиентом. Эта инфа хранится в БД сайта и, по запросу, отправляется клиенту в виде СМС (если ввести его номер телефона на спец.странице сайта).
1. В БД сейчас за клиентом хранится только 1 код. Нужно добавить до 10-ти кодов, чтобы генерировалось 10-ть разных кодов к каждому клиенту, а не 1 как сейчас.
2. На странице отправки СМС-кода клиенту, по вводу его номера телефона, нужно чтобы система отправляла каждый код по-очередно. Т.е., если отправка кода под номером 1 уже была, отправлять - 2-й, и так далее. После того, как будет отправлен последний код (10-й).. сообщать о том, что все коды были использованы и нужно обратиться в офис + делать где-то запись о том (для администраторов) что коды по этому клиенту использованы... При следующей генерации кодов, - журнал\запись очищаем.
3. Потом эти коды мы выгружаем в XML.
Нужно чтобы в поле sms_code попадали все 10-ть ново-сгенерированных кодов из БД.
Пример записи в хмл файле по одному клиенту:
<card>
<new_card>98***********</new_card>
<prev_card>99***********</prev_card>
<status_card>0</status_card>
<locking>0</locking>
<username>Иванов Иван Иванович</username>
<email>[email protected]</email>
<phone_1>380500000000</phone_1>
<birthday>01.01.1980</birthday>
<sms_code>400410</sms_code> << сейчас это 1 код (6-ти значное число)
<message_cashier></message_cashier>
<smsbulk>3</smsbulk>
</card>
4. В админке фильтр таблички иногда подвисает при поиске по номеру карточки.
Если решить не удастся, то просто убрать фильтр по этому значению.
5. Проверить чтобы при перегенерации смс-кодов, выгружались в ХМЛ все активные карты с новыми кодами.
---
ps. в отпуске с 16 по 22 октября.
Отзыв заказчика о сотрудничестве с Artem Ilchenko
Несколько доработок на самописном сайте (добавить коды)Уровень профессионализма 11 из 10 🙂
Работаем не впервые, а впечатления от сотрудничества только положительные!
Отзыв фрилансера о сотрудничестве с Dim U.
Несколько доработок на самописном сайте (добавить коды)Уже в который раз остался доволен сотрудничеством.
Человек знает чего хочет, отлично объясняет, всегда на связи и оплата своевременная.
-
Здравствуйте, сделаю без проблем, обращайтесь.
email: [email protected]
skype: live:dfda433685539a7f
-
Победившая ставка3 дня1000 UAH
565 21 0 Победившая ставка3 дня1000 UAHГотов выполнить, приступлю сразу как получу необходимые доступы.
-
37 1 1 Здравствуйте. Самопис в любых связках ето все моя стихия. Обращайтесь.
Актуальные фриланс-проекты в категории HTML и CSS верстка
Разработка iOS-приложения для онлайн-шахмат аналога (возможно через Vibe Coding)
20 000 UAH
Необходимо разработать MVP мобильного приложения только под iOS. В качестве основы можно взять концепцию Chess.com, но без копирования дизайна или кода. Желательно максимально использовать Vibe Coding/AI для ускорения разработки и снижения стоимости, но код должен быть чистым,… HTML и CSS верстка ∙ 10 часов 34 минуты назад ∙ 24 ставки |
Ищем специалиста по ДжумлеВсем привет, есть проект, по которому нужен специалист по Джумле. Сейчас нужно разобраться, как там всё устроено и какие есть страницы. Найти страницу и форму регистрации и рассказать, показать, как всё работает и куда идут заявки и т. д. HTML и CSS верстка ∙ 12 часов 4 минуты назад ∙ 20 ставок |
Веб-дизайн и разработкаПривет! Для текущего проекта ищу двух отдельных специалистов: веб-дизайнера (Figma) веб-разработчика (Frontend / WordPress) Проект включает задачи по типу: лендинги, интернет-магазин, админ-панели, сайт на WordPress, а также при необходимости небольшие задачи на React /… HTML и CSS верстка, Дизайн сайтов ∙ 3 дня 13 часов назад ∙ 115 ставок |
Нужен разработчик Drupal для правок на нескольких сайтах.Нужен разработчик Drupal для правок на нескольких сайтах. Сайт раздувается и заполняет весь хостинг .. HTML и CSS верстка, Веб-программирование ∙ 3 дня 21 час назад ∙ 39 ставок |
Оптимизация скорости сайта WordPress
5092 UAH
полные детали отправим в личные сообщения Цель Максимально ускорить загрузку сайта, особенно на мобильных устройствах. KPI (обязательно) После завершения работ необходимо добиться следующих показателей. Mobile Performance 90+ LCP менее 2.2 сек INP менее 200 мс CLS менее 0.1… HTML и CSS верстка, Javascript и Typescript ∙ 4 дня 12 часов назад ∙ 68 ставок |